Here’s how to help your flowers beat the heat:
-
Hydration is Key
Re-cut your stems at an angle and place them in cool water immediately. Refill the vase with clean water every two days. -
Avoid Direct Sunlight
It might seem counterintuitive, but even sun-loving flowers wilt faster in direct sun once cut. Keep arrangements in a cool, shaded spot indoors. -
Keep Away from Appliances
Don’t place flowers near ovens, radiators, or air conditioning vents. These can cause dehydration and wilting. -
Remove Foliage Below Water Line
Any leaves submerged in water will decay quickly and promote bacteria growth, which shortens your flowers’ lifespan. -
Use Flower Food
